Regions Bank Office Culture At a Glance

Regions Bank employees rank their office culture a "C" or 60/100. 11 employees provided feedback on their office culture and whether it's a productive and collaborative environment.

83% of employees at Regions Bank have a close friend at work.Most employees are burnt out and also feel like they have a work life balance in their position.Compared to its competitors, Capital One, Wells Fargo, Bank of America, and SunTrust Banks, Regions Bank's office culture ranks in 4th place.

African American/Black employees and Female employees are the most satisfied with the office culture, while employees with Over 10 Years experience and Male employees believe there is room for improvement. Regions Bank ranks in the Bottom 40% of 641 similar sized companies with 10,000+ Employees on Comparably.
